1.为什么写?comparator 是javase中的接口,位于java.util包下,该接口抽象度极高,有必要掌握该接口的使用大多数文章告诉大家comparator是用来排序,但我想说排序是comparator能实现的功能之一,他不仅限于排序2.接口功能该接口代表一个比较器,比较器具有可比性!大多数文章都写如何用comparator排序,是因为javase数组工具类和集合工具类中提供的sort方
转载
2023-07-10 16:18:22
44阅读
十、几种排序算法的比较和选择1. 选取排序方法需要考虑的因素:(1) 待排序的元素数目n;(2) 元素本身信息量的大小;(3) 关键字的结构及其分布情况;(4) 语言工具的条件,辅助空间的大小等。2. 小结:(1) 若n较小(n <= 50),则可以采用直接插入排序或直接选择排序。由于直接插入排序所需的记录移动操作较直接选择排序多,因而当记录本身信息量较大时,用直接选择排序较好。(2) 若文
在学习算法的过程中,我们难免会接触很多和排序相关的算法。总而言之,对于任何编程人员来说,基本的排序算法是必须要掌握的。从今天开始,我们将要进行基本的排序算法的讲解。Are you ready?Let‘s go~~~1、排序算法的基本概念的讲解时间复杂度:需要排序的的关键字的比较次数和相应的移动的次数。空间复杂度:分析需要多少辅助的内存。稳定性:如果记录两个关键字的A和B它们的值相等,经过排序后它们
转载
2024-08-12 17:28:52
29阅读
## Java Controller 多个字段排序入参定义
在开发过程中,我们经常需要对数据进行排序。例如,对一个学生列表按照姓名或者年龄进行排序。通常情况下,我们可以在控制器中定义多个参数来实现排序功能。本文将介绍如何在Java控制器中定义多个字段的排序入参,并提供相应的代码示例。
### 排序入参定义
在排序功能中,我们通常需要指定排序的字段和排序的方式(升序或降序)。我们可以通过在控制
原创
2023-12-21 08:10:52
322阅读
# 实现Java Controller调Controller的流程
作为一名经验丰富的开发者,我将教你如何实现Java Controller调Controller的功能。这个功能可以让不同的Controller之间相互调用,实现代码的复用和逻辑的解耦。
## 流程概述
下面是实现Java Controller调Controller的整个流程:
| 步骤 | 描述 |
| --- | ---
原创
2024-01-07 10:49:34
99阅读
# 教程:如何实现Java Controller集成Controller
## 一、整个流程
下面是实现Java Controller集成Controller的流程表格: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个基础Controller类 |
| 2 | 创建要集成的Controller类 |
| 3 | 让要集成的Controller类继承基础Contr
原创
2024-04-14 04:44:08
56阅读
Java中的控制器(Controller)是实现业务逻辑的关键部分之一。在开发Web应用程序时,我们通常使用控制器来处理用户请求,并根据请求的类型和参数进行相应的操作。本文将介绍Java控制器的基本概念和用法,并提供代码示例进行演示。
## 什么是控制器?
在Java开发中,控制器是一个组件,用于接收和处理用户请求。它承担着业务逻辑的实现和请求处理的责任。控制器负责接收用户请求,调用相应的服务
原创
2024-01-26 11:14:48
116阅读
# Java Controller 跳转 Controller 的实现
在 Java web 开发中,尤其是使用 Spring 框架的时候,Controller 是处理用户请求的重要组件。有时,我们可能需要从一个 Controller 跳转到另一个 Controller。那么,如何实现这个过程呢?
本文将详细讲解 Java Controller 跳转到另一个 Controller 的流程,并提
原创
2024-10-25 04:01:49
64阅读
# 如何实现“Java Controller 请求Controller”
作为一名经验丰富的开发者,我将帮助你理解并学习如何实现“Java Controller 请求Controller”的过程。在本文中,我将向你展示整个流程,并提供每个步骤所需的代码示例和注释。
## 流程图
```mermaid
flowchart TD
A(定义请求的URL和方法) --> B(创建Contro
原创
2024-01-17 05:34:53
106阅读
---执行流程---1、用户发送请求至前端控制器DispatcherServlet2、DispatcherServlet收到请求调用HandlerMapping处理器映射器。3、处理器映射器根据请求url找到具体的处理器,生成处理器对象及处理器拦截器(如果有则生成)一并返回给DispatcherServlet。4、DispatcherServlet通过HandlerAdapter处理器适配器调用处
转载
2023-08-08 08:19:17
297阅读
@ControllerAdvice ,很多初学者可能都没有听说过这个注解,实际上,这是一个非常有用的注解,顾名思义,这是一个增强的 Controller。使用这个 Controller ,可以实现三个方面的功能:全局异常处理全局数据绑定全局数据预处理全局异常处理使用 @ControllerAdvice 实现全局异常处理,只需要定义类,添加该注解即可定义方式如下:@ControllerAdvice
转载
2023-07-10 16:19:08
108阅读
这里默认你使用的编辑器是idea,并且电脑上安装了Java以及tomcat,并且在idea里面初步配置了tomcat,电脑里面下载了spring。 首先简单介绍一下controller控制器:控制器复杂提供访问应用程序的行为,通常通过接口定义或注解定义两种方法实现。控制器负责解析用户的请求并将其转换为一个模型。在Spring MVC中一个控制器类可以包含多个方法在Spring MVC中,对于Con
转载
2023-08-06 12:02:59
109阅读
# Java Controller 能调用 Controller:深入解析
在Java的Web框架中,尤其是Spring框架中,Controller是一个重要的概念。Controller主要用于处理用户请求并返回相应的结果。在某些情况下,我们可能需要在一个Controller中调用另一个Controller的逻辑。这种需求并不是非常常见,但在一些特定的场景下,可能会带来更好的代码结构和可维护性。
MVC模型中的控制器负责解析用户的输入信息,并将之变换处理后传入一个model,而这个model则可能被呈现给发起请求的用户。Spring以非常 抽象的方式体现了控制器的理念,从而开发人员在创建controller时将有多种选择。Spring包含了3类controller:处理HTML表单 的controller,基于command的controller,和向导风格的controller。 &nb
转载
2023-11-01 20:42:23
73阅读
# Java Controller调用Controller的方案
在开发Java Web应用时,我们常常需要多个Controller之间进行交互,以实现更加复杂的业务逻辑。本文将探讨如何在Spring MVC框架中实现Controller之间的调用,并提供代码示例。我们将以一个具体的实例为背景,展示如何在两个Controller之间传递数据并实现功能。
## 背景
假设我们正在开发一个在线订
原创
2024-09-18 05:40:24
84阅读
# 实现Java Controller调用其他Controller
## 1. 整体流程
为了实现Java Controller调用其他Controller的功能,我们可以按照以下步骤进行操作:
| 步骤 | 操作 |
|---|---|
| 1 | 创建需要调用的Controller类 |
| 2 | 在调用的Controller类中添加需要调用的方法 |
| 3 | 在调用的Contro
原创
2023-10-29 06:49:24
205阅读
# Java Controller层调用Controller的实现步骤
作为一名经验丰富的开发者,我将会教会你如何在Java的Controller层调用另一个Controller。下面将会展示整个流程,并附上每一步所需的代码以及代码注释。
## 整体流程
首先,我们需要了解整个流程的步骤。下表展示了调用Controller的实现步骤:
| 步骤 | 操作 |
| --- | --- |
|
原创
2023-12-18 12:33:48
186阅读
在Java Web开发中,"Controller"是处理用户请求和响应的核心部分。有时,我们需要从一个Controller调用另一个Controller,这可能会造成一些不必要的复杂性,但有正确的方法去处理这个问题。本文将以轻松的语气和结构化的方式,展示如何有效解决“Java Controller调用其他Controller”的难题。
## 环境准备
首先,为了使我们的解决方案有效,我们需要准
# 如何实现controller调用controller java
## 问题背景
在实际的软件开发中,经常会遇到需要在一个controller中调用另一个controller的情况。这种场景可能出现在多个接口需要共享某些功能的情况下,或者某个接口需要调用另一个接口的某个方法等。本文将介绍如何实现controller调用controller java的方法,并提供代码示例。
## 方案解析
在
原创
2024-03-17 06:44:53
151阅读
# Java Spring Controller 调用 Controller 的实现指南
在 Java Spring 框架中,我们通常会使用控制器(Controller)来处理请求并为用户提供响应。然而,在某些情况下,我们可能需要在一个控制器内部调用另一个控制器。这通常是为了实现代码复用或业务逻辑的一致性。本文将详细介绍如何实现“Java Spring Controller 调用 Control